1999 Chevrolet S-10 vs. 2009 Ford Edge
To start off, 2009 Ford Edge is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Chevrolet S-10.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Chevrolet S-10 would be higher. At 4,293 cc (6 cylinders), 1999 Chevrolet S-10 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Ford Edge (265 HP @ 6250 RPM) has 88 more horse power than 1999 Chevrolet S-10. (177 HP @ 4400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Ford Edge should accelerate faster than 1999 Chevrolet S-10.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Chevrolet S-10 weights approximately 534 kg more than 2009 Ford Edge.
Let's talk about torque, 2009 Ford Edge (339 Nm @ 4500 RPM) has 7 more torque (in Nm) than 1999 Chevrolet S-10. (332 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 2009 Ford Edge will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1999 Chevrolet S-10.
